3.0 Neuroplasticity: The Changing Brain
Neuroplasticity is the brain’s lifelong ability to reorganize and form new neural connections in response to learning and experience.
3.1 Key Concepts
-
Learning physically changes the brain.
-
Repeated practice strengthens neural pathways.
-
Emotional experiences influence memory and attention.
-
Brain development continues into adulthood—especially in areas like impulse control and decision-making.
🧠 “Neurons that fire together, wire together.” – Hebbian Learning Principle
3.2 Implications for Teaching
-
Emphasize growth mindset: abilities can develop with effort.
-
Use spaced repetition and multisensory instruction.
-
Integrate emotionally engaging activities like storytelling, music, or personal relevance.
-
Provide timely feedback to reinforce learning.
4.0 Trauma-Informed Education
Many students face adverse experiences (e.g., abuse, neglect, displacement) that affect their behavior and brain function.
4.1 Effects of Trauma on Learning
-
Heightened stress response impairs attention and memory.
-
Reduced trust and increased emotional reactivity.
-
Difficulty with self-regulation and executive function.
4.2 Trauma-Informed Teaching Strategies
Strategy | Purpose |
---|---|
Safe Environment | Predictability, routines, and structure |
Restorative Practices | Repairing relationships and accountability |
Empathy and Listening | Building trust through consistent support |
Mindfulness Techniques | Reducing anxiety and improving focus |
💡 A calm, supportive teacher can help regulate an emotionally overwhelmed student.
5.0 Emerging Trends in Educational Technology
Modern classrooms are increasingly shaped by digital innovations. When integrated thoughtfully, these tools can enhance personalized learning and access.
5.1 Artificial Intelligence (AI) in Education
-
Adaptive Learning Platforms (e.g., Khan Academy, DreamBox): Tailor content to student pace and level.
-
AI Tutoring: Real-time, automated feedback (e.g., chatbots, intelligent writing assistants).
-
Predictive Analytics: Use student data to flag learning gaps or at-risk learners.
5.2 Virtual & Augmented Reality (VR/AR)
-
Simulated environments for science labs, history tours, or medical training.
-
Immersive, engaging content that enhances memory retention.
5.3 Assistive Technologies
-
Text-to-speech/speech-to-text tools for reading/writing difficulties.
-
Screen readers, closed captioning, and communication apps for students with disabilities.
5.4 Learning Management Systems (LMS)
-
Platforms like Moodle, Canvas, or Google Classroom organize content, track performance, and facilitate remote learning.
6.0 Ethical Considerations and Equity
-
Data Privacy: Student data must be protected from misuse.
-
Digital Divide: Ensure all students have equal access to devices and internet.
-
Over-Reliance Risk: Technology should enhance, not replace, meaningful human interaction.
-
Teacher Training: Educators must be equipped to integrate tools purposefully and ethically.
